The Psoriasis Association Re-certified by The Information Standard

We have met the requirements of The Information Standard for another year.

We are delighted to announce that we have achieved re-certification from The Information Standard for another year. As a result, you can be sure that the information we provide is both accurate and reliable.

The Information Standard page on the NHS England website states:

'The Information Standard is a certification programme for all organisations producing evidence-based health and care information for the public. Any organisation achieving The Information Standard has undergone a rigorous assessment of the information production process to ensure that the information they produce is high quality, evidence based, balanced, user-led, clear and accurate.'

As providing information resources helps to fulfil two of our aims: to support people who are living with psoriasis; and to help raise awareness of the condition, it is vitally important that our information is accurate and up to date.
